Glen Waverley Shopping Centre

Vermont South, VIC ,Australia
Glen Waverley Shopping Centre Glen Waverley Shopping Centre is one of the popular Shopping Mall located in ,Vermont South listed under Local business in Vermont South , Shopping Mall in Vermont South ,

Contact Details & Working Hours

Map of Glen Waverley Shopping Centre